I've often wanted just Markdown syntax coloring. Still text, not HTML -- but 
with the same kind of syntax coloring you'd see in BBEdit or TextMate.

The syntax coloring makes the structure more evident and makes the message more 
readable. It's a nice compromise between plain text and HTML -- you get 
structure without the swamp of HTML.

Great for sending out change notes to a beta mailing list, for instance.

But this is surely plugin-land, I would think.
